8f8ad0238bddc4476e5968f8ae5fe836bbe8c714ce20b4d4e304820c24ab66f1

1870287 (1231 blocks ago)

347526764

⏴ Block 1870286 (22f46722...904) | Block 1870288 ⏵ | Latest block ⏭

Metadata

6/15/25, 6:56 AM UTC (16d 14:18:12 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 32.8797 SENT

Transactions (0)

Show raw details